Rosalinda saved $35 in 5 weeks. Her sister saved $56 in 56 days. Are the rates at which each sister saved equivalent? Explain yo
ur reasoning.
2 answers:
Yes, because when you multiply 5 weeks by 7 days in a week, you get 35 days. It is equivalent.
Answer:Explained
Step-by-step explanation:
Given
Rosalinda saved $35 in 5 weeks
Thus Rosalinda gets $ 7 in 1 week
for 1 day rosalinda paid $ 1
For her sister, she earns $ 56 in 56 days
For 1 day she earned $ 1
Thus rate at which both are paid is equal.
